Chemical, biological, radiological and nuclear defense specialist U.S. Marines assigned to the 26th Marine Expeditionary Unit (MEU), lift a casualty over an obstacle during a confined space search and rescue exercise aboard the USS Kearsarge (LHD 3), at sea, May 9, 2013. The 26th MEU is deployed to the 5th Fleet area of operations aboard the Kearsarge Amphibious Ready Group. The 26th MEU operates continuously across the globe, providing the president and unified combatant commanders with a forward-deployed, sea-based quick reaction force. The MEU is a Marine Air-Ground Task Force capable of conducting amphibious operations, crisis response and limited contingency operations. (U.S. Marine Corps photograph by Cpl. Kyle N.
